Broadcast Engineer

Sinclair Broadcast Group, Eugene, OR, United States


KMTR/KVAL has an excellent career opportunity for a full-time Broadcast Engineer to support and maintain the technical infrastructure that powers our television stations, digital platforms, and evolving media technologies. This role is responsible for the installation, maintenance, and troubleshooting of a wide range of broadcast and IT systems used in live production and station operations. The ideal candidate brings a strong technical foundation, independent problem‑solving ability, and hands‑on experience with broadcast and networked systems.

Responsibilities

Install, maintain, and repair broadcast and IT‑based technical systems

Diagnose and resolve complex video, audio, and signal flow issues across production and master control environments

Maintain and support systems including video servers, editing/playback systems, automation systems, switchers, routing, encoders/decoders, newsroom systems, cameras, audio consoles, and intercoms

Ensure reliability and uptime of critical systems during live broadcasts and news production

Provide technical guidance and support to newsroom, production, and operations teams

Maintain and update technical documentation and system configurations

Support network‑connected broadcast infrastructure and IT systems

Assist Engineering with Transmitter maintenance

Respond to and resolve technical issues through helpdesk workflows

Execute preventative maintenance and contribute to upgrades and projects

Collaborate with engineering leadership on system improvements

Requirements

1 year of related broadcast experience

A great team‑oriented attitude and dedication to quality

Strong familiarity with Microsoft, Mac and Linux operating systems

Knowledge and competency in core hardware and computer system technologies, including installation, configuration, diagnosing, preventive maintenance and LAN/WAN networking

Proficiency in troubleshooting problems and responding quickly under pressure

Excellent communication skills

Familiarity with Avid related software and hardware products a plus

Physical Demands/Work Environment

Must be able to work a flexible schedule

On‑call duty, including weekends and holidays

Ability to lift computers and equipment generally less than 50 pounds
